Création de résultat
Tous les outils et les opérateurs Algèbre spatial produisent un résultat. Pour la plupart des outils et opérateurs Algèbre spatial, un objet raster est le résultat (la sortie) à gauche d'un signe égal.
Règles en sortie
- Les opérateurs ou outils qui génèrent un raster produisent un objet raster identifié à gauche d'un signe égal. Dans ce cas, l'objet Raster pointe sur un jeu de données raster temporaire.
outSlope = Slope("indem")
- L'objet raster en sortie créé à partir d'une instruction peut être directement utilisé dans les instructions suivantes.
outDirection = FlowDirection("inelevation") outAccumulation = FlowAccumulation(outDirection)
- Le jeu de données raster référencé de l'objet raster obtenu est temporaire et sera supprimé du disque à la fin de la session ArcGIS. Vous pouvez enregistrer le jeu de données raster référencé de façon permanente en appelant la méthode save sur l'objet raster.
outSlope = Slope("indem") outSlope.save("sloperaster")
Pour plus d'informations sur l'objet raster et ses propriétés et méthodes, consultez la rubrique Création d'un objet raster.
- Lorsqu'un outil peut créer plusieurs sorties, la sortie facultative s'exprime en tant que paramètres d'outil et est entourée de parenthèses à droite du signe égal. Les sorties raster facultatives sont des jeux de données permanents sur le disque. Il ne s'agit pas d'objets raster.
# Empty "" indicate use the default values for the parameter. # In the following statement the defaults are taken for # maximum_distance and cell_size parameters. outdirection will be a # a permanent raster stored in the current workspace outDistance = EucDistance("input", "", "", "outdirection")
- Quelques outils dans l'Extension ArcGIS Spatial Analyst ne génèrent pas de raster, tels que l'outil Isoligne. Ils expriment la sortie en tant que paramètre au sein de parenthèses dans la définition de l'outil.
Contour("elevation", "C:/sapyexamples/output/outcontours.shp", 200, 0)
Thèmes connexes
5/10/2014